Our MP Greg Rickford On Parliament Hill Shootings

Greg Rickford is in shock after learning about the shots fired at Parliament Hill.
The Kenora M.P. was on his way to the Hill this morning to present in caucus, when his driver told him everything was on lock down.
Rickford says he is very concerned for the safety of his M.P. colleagues and he has an office on the Hill.
He says as far as he knows the gunman has not been captured.
Media reports say shots were also fired at Ottawa’s war memorial where a soldier was wounded.
According to a tweet from the Prime Minister’s Office, Stephen Harper is safe.
Minister Tony Clement tweeted that shots were fired during caucus meeting with at least 30 shots.
Clement went on to say that MPs’ piled out and that he is safe with 2 colleagues but they are still at risk.

Media reports indicate three shootings have taken place on Parliament Hill and nearby.
